Captivating African Lace Dress Styles For Every Occasion
African lace dress styles exemplify the vibrant and diverse fashion traditions of the African continent. These dresses are characterized by their intricate lacework, which is often handmade using traditional techniques passed down through generations.
African lace dress styles are not only beautiful but also hold cultural significance. They are often worn for special occasions such as weddings, festivals, and religious ceremonies. The lacework on these dresses can represent different symbols and meanings, such as fertility, prosperity, and good luck.
In recent years, African lace dress styles have gained popularity around the world. This is due in part to the growing appreciation of African culture and fashion. African lace dresses are now worn by people of all backgrounds and cultures, and they are often seen on the runways of major fashion shows.

Cultural diversity
African lace dress styles are a reflection of the diverse cultures of the African continent. Each region has its own unique style of lacework, which is often influenced by the local culture and traditions.
- Materials and Techniques: The materials and techniques used to make African lace vary from region to region. For example, in Nigeria, lace is often made from cotton or silk, while in Ghana, it is often made from raffia or jute. The lacework itself can also vary, with some regions using intricate needlework while others use more simple techniques.
- Designs and Patterns: The designs and patterns used in African lace also vary from region to region. Some regions, such as Nigeria, are known for their bold and colorful designs, while others, such as Mali, are known for their more subtle and delicate patterns.
- Cultural Significance: African lace dress styles also have different cultural significance in different regions. In some regions, lace is worn for special occasions such as weddings and festivals, while in other regions it is worn more casually. The meaning of the lacework can also vary, with some designs representing fertility, prosperity, or good luck.
The cultural diversity of African lace dress styles is a testament to the richness and diversity of African culture. These dresses are a beautiful and unique expression of the creativity and artistry of the African people.

Tips for Choosing the Perfect African Lace Dress
African lace dress styles are a popular choice for weddings, parties, and other special occasions. With so many different styles and designs to choose from, it can be difficult to know where to start. Here are a few tips to help you choose the perfect African lace dress for your next event:
Consider the occasion. The type of event you are attending will help you narrow down your choices. For example, a simple and elegant dress may be more appropriate for a wedding, while a more elaborate and eye-catching dress may be better suited for a party.
Choose the right color. African lace dresses come in a wide variety of colors, so it is important to choose a color that complements your skin tone and personal style. If you are not sure what color to choose, you can always consult with a fashion stylist.
Select the right size. African lace dresses are often made to order, so it is important to choose the right size. Be sure to measure yourself carefully before ordering a dress, and be sure to provide the seller with your measurements.
Accessorize accordingly. African lace dresses can be dressed up or down with accessories. For a more formal occasion, you can add a statement necklace, earrings, and heels. For a more casual occasion, you can add sandals and a headscarf.
Care for your dress properly. African lace is a delicate fabric, so it is important to care for your dress properly. Hand wash your dress in cold water and hang it to dry. Avoid using bleach or harsh detergents.
